Repeat customers have a significant impact on the success of an ecommerce business. A repeat customer is someone who makes multiple purchases from your website over a certain period of time. They are invaluable sources of revenue for your business and their loyalty serves as an indicator of customer satisfaction. By understanding the formula, example, and importance of repeat customers, as well as strategies to improve them, you can gain valuable insights into your business and customer retention.
Repeat Customers = (Total Customers - New Customers)
Repeat customers are essential for any ecommerce business as they account for a significant portion of revenue. By keeping customers engaged, businesses can build customer loyalty and brand recognition. Additionally, the more purchases a customer makes, the more likely they are to promote your products to their friends and family. This is an important factor in organic growth and should be taken into account when building your customer loyalty strategy.
Improving your repeat customer orders can be done through various strategies such as offering specialized discounts or loyalty programs, creating personalized experiences, and providing excellent customer service to ensure they have a positive experience with each purchase. Additionally, businesses should look for ways to foster customer engagement and build relationships with their most loyal customers, such as offering exclusive promotions or providing more targeted product recommendations.
Repeat customers are heavily impacted by the customer experience, both in terms of their satisfaction with the product/service as well as the customer service they receive. Additionally, customer loyalty can be influenced by factors such as exclusive discounts, loyalty programs, personalized experiences, and relevant product recommendations.
The number of repeat customers is closely linked to other ecommerce metrics such as customer loyalty, customer retention, and organic growth. Additionally, repeat customers can provide insight into customer satisfaction and engagement, which are essential metrics for optimizing the customer experience. By consistently monitoring and improving repeat customers, businesses can maximize revenue growth, customer satisfaction, and brand recognition.
